Brian Berman, director of the Center for Integrative Medicine at the University of Maryland School of Medicine, for example, has the longest and largest randomized, controlled phase III study the effect of acupuncture on osteoarthritis of the knee. An ancient Chinese practice, acupuncture has been more than two millennia to relieve pain, strengthen the immune system and treat a wide variety of complaints about the inclusion and the promotion of small needles at specific points on the body. Patients' pain and knee function were at regular intervals, and the final results showed that the acupuncture patients reduced their pain by forty percent, and improved knee function by the same percentage increase.
